Account Manager

Objective: This is an outbound sales role. You will be responsible for on-boarding new clients for Nielsen Brandbank, trading off the back of retailer endorsements and new product launches to ensure suppliers and brand owners are listing their content with us, primarily through phone and email communication.

You will then maintain those client relationships, growing the accounts through cross selling additional products and services. The role is measured based on revenue performance and key business development objectives.

Your main responsibilities as Account Manager at Nielsen will be:

Contacting suppliers to sell the Nielsen Brandbank solution; communicating our value proposition to win their business and generate revenue. This will be done primarily via phone and email, but occasionally face to face (as required)

Accurately forecasting revenue to the US Commercial Manager, ensuring there is a consistently strong pipeline to deliver core targets. This is generally on a monthly basis, but you may be asked to provide additional forecasts at your manager’s discretion

Converting retailer “chase ranges” of new products, to support the drive to deliver coverage of content for Nielsen Brandbank retail partners. You will contact suppliers via phone and email to schedule product deliveries and confirm associated processing costs

Developing a full understanding of the Nielsen Brandbank value proposition (both related to core service and additional software products), in order to sell the solution to your supplier base, and to support with handling any objections that may be raised

Building a rapport with your supplier base once on-boarded, frequently contacting them to understand their service requirements and identify potential areas where Nielsen Brandbank can further support their business objectives. This will support both revenue growth and customer satisfaction

Managing and negotiating annual renewals across your supplier base, with the aim of growing revenue across your portfolio in line with Nielsen Brandbank business objectives

Either directly selling, or supporting the sale, of our additional products & services beyond the core subscription service – this includes licensed software products and professional services solutions.

Scheduling product deliveries around our workflow capacity, dealing with operational queries and generally supporting our operations team to ensure we deliver a good level of service in all instances
